Are two-level inverters suitable for a utility grid?

Conventional two-level inverters when used as an interface between PV sources and the grid (Myrzik, 2001, Kjaer et al., 2005) were found unsuitable for the medium and high voltage utility grid due to a smaller number of output voltage levels (Colak et al., 2011a) and hence, greater harmonics in the injected grid current.
